For some reason, my VEPro 7 slave, on Windows 11, will only see AmpliTube's VST3 plugins when it is installed on my system drive (c://), using the standard installation paths. I would like to install AmpliTube on my F:// drive, which is also an m.2 NVME drive, because Amplitube is such a CPU and IO heavy app. But, any install on my F://, of any AmpliTube component, renders it's VST3 plugins invisible to VEPro. The VST2 plugs do show up. Is there something obvious that I am missing? Thanks, Dennis
